Final answer:

The statement is false; the formula to determine "And" probabilities varies depending on whether events are independent or dependent.

Explanation:

The statement "And" probabilities can always be determined using the formula P(A and B) = P(A) - P(B) is false. The correct method to determine the probability of two events A and B occurring together, also known as the conjunction, depends on whether the events are independent or dependent. If A and B are independent, the formula is P(A and B) = P(A) × P(B). However, if A and B are dependent, you must use the formula P(A and B) = P(A) × P(B|A), where P(B|A) represents the conditional probability of B given that A has already occurred.

4x-7y=15 and 5x-2y=12

Answers

Presumably we're being asked to solve the system.  

4x - 7y = 15

5x - 2y = 12

We don't really have any common factors among the coefficients of x, or among the coefficients of y, so we can do the general thing. To eliminate y multiply the first equation by (typically the absolute value of) the coefficient of y in the second equation and vice verse, then add or subtract equations to eliminate.  

First equation times 2:

8x - 14y = 30

Second equation times 7:

35x - 14y = 84

Subtract,

27x = 54

x = 54/27 = 2

2y = 5x - 12 = 10 - 12 = -2

y = -1

Answer: x=2, y = -1

Check:

4(2)-7(-1)=8+7=15, good

5(2) -2(-1) = 10 + 2 = 12, good

-----

If you do enough of these 2x2 linear systems you can learn to just write down the answer.  I usually remember the matrix inverse, but if you haven't gotten there you can just remember the pattern:  

ax + by = c    

dx + ey = f

has solutions

x = (ce-bf)/(ae-bd), y = (a f-cd)/(ae-bd)

4x - 7y = 15    

5x - 2y = 12

has solutions

denom = ae-bd = 4(-2) - (-7)(5) = 27

x = (15(-2) - (-7)(12))/27 = (-30 + 84)/27 = 2

y = (4(12)-15(5))/27 = (48-75)/27 = -27/27 = -1

what is the nth term for 7,11,15,19

Answers

Answer:

[tex]a_{n}[/tex] = 4n + 3

Step-by-step explanation:

Note there is a common difference d between consecutive terms, that is

d = 11 - 7 = 15 - 11 = 19 - 15 = 4

This indicates the sequence is arithmetic with n th term

[tex]a_{n}[/tex] = a₁ + (n - 1)d

where a₁ is the first term and d the common difference

Here a₁ = 7 and d = 4, thus

[tex]a_{n}[/tex] = 7 + 4(n - 1) = 7 + 4n - 4 = 4n + 3

If a line plot represents 12 pieces of data, how many dots does it have?
Enter your answer in the box.

Answers

Hence, there are 12 pieces of data in the given line lot, so there will be 12 dots.

Step-by-step explanation:

A line plot is a graph that shows frequency of data along a number line. It is best to use a line plot when comparing fewer than 25 numbers. It is a quick, simple way to organize data.

The main difference between a line plot and a line graph is that the line plot shows the frequency of number within a set, and the line graph shows the value of one variable relative to another.The number of dots  in a line plot will be equal to the number of data points.
